When was the last time you did something just for yourself? Something that filled your bucket, sparked your creativity, and left you feeling inspired?

Join us on Wednesday, July 15 at 11 AM CST for a special digital gathering with Kalin Sheick, founder of Sweetwater Floral, for a floral workshop designed to bring a little more beauty, creativity, and inspiration into the middle of your summer.

Settle in with an iced coffee or Diet Coke and take an hour for yourself as Kalin guides us through creating a relaxed, garden-inspired floral arrangement together from home.

Ahead of the event, Kalin will share a simple flower recipe so you can source blooms locally, gather flowers from your own garden, or opt for the easiest option: a curated floral kit delivered directly to your doorstep from Sweetwater Floral. All you'll need is a vase. Additional information about ordering floral kits will be shared with registered attendees in a separate email.

And honestly, if you'd rather simply sit back and watch a master floral designer at work, you can absolutely do that too. There's something incredibly calming and inspiring about watching beauty come together in real time.

As we arrange flowers together, Kalin will also share the story behind building Sweetwater Floral from a small garage startup into one of Northern Michigan's most beloved creative brands. The conversation will touch on entrepreneurship, creativity, motherhood, risk-taking, and the beauty of building a life rooted in purpose and connection.

She'll also reflect on the inspiration behind her TEDx talk and her belief that flowers are about far more than design. They create gathering, spark emotion, and remind us to notice the beauty already around us.

Think of it as part floral workshop, part creative reset, and part summer gathering with women from around the country.
